Embark on a memorable journey through the stunning region of Andalucia in southern Spain, filled with rich history, fascinating culture, and breathtaking landscapes. This 7-day itinerary will take you from Malaga to Sevilla, and finally to Granada, ensuring you make the most of your time in this enchanting destination.
Morning: Begin your journey in Malaga, the gateway to Andalucia. Explore the historic city center, starting with a visit to the awe-inspiring Alcazaba fortress, followed by a wander through the charming old town of Casco Antiguo.
Afternoon: Immerse yourself in art at the Picasso Museum, dedicated to the celebrated artist who was born in Malaga. Take a leisurely stroll along the picturesque promenade of La Malagueta Beach, enjoying the views of the Mediterranean Sea.
Evening: Treat yourself to some delicious tapas and local wine at a traditional tavern in the lively neighborhood of El Palo, known for its authentic atmosphere.
Morning: Travel to Seville, the vibrant capital of Andalucia. Start your day by visiting the grand Seville Cathedral, the largest Gothic cathedral in the world. Climb to the top of the Giralda Tower for panoramic views of the city.
Afternoon: Explore the beautiful Alcazar of Seville, a stunning royal palace known for its intricate Moorish architecture and enchanting gardens.
Evening: Join the festive New Year's Eve celebrations in Seville. Head to the iconic Plaza de España, where people gather to welcome the new year with music, fireworks, and a lively atmosphere. Indulge in traditional Spanish delicacies at a local restaurant and toast to a memorable year filled with new experiences.
Morning: Take a leisurely walk through the charming Triana neighborhood, known for its vibrant atmosphere and traditional ceramics. Visit the Triana Market and sample local products.
Afternoon: Discover the magic of Flamenco at a traditional tablao in Seville. Watch passionate performers showcase their skills in this iconic Spanish dance form.
Evening: Enjoy a relaxing evening by taking a romantic river cruise along the Guadalquivir River, admiring the illuminated bridges and landmarks of Seville.
Morning: Visit the Maria Luisa Park, a peaceful oasis in the heart of the city. Explore the park's lush gardens, fountains, and charming pavilions.
Afternoon: Immerse yourself in history at the Archive of the Indies, a UNESCO World Heritage Site that houses valuable documents relating to the Spanish colonization of the Americas. Learn about Spain's influential role in shaping the New World.
Evening: Indulge in a traditional Spanish dinner at a local tavern and savor authentic Andalusian cuisine.
Morning: Travel to Granada, a city renowned for its magnificent Moorish architecture. Start the day by visiting the world-famous Alhambra, a stunning palace complex with intricate Islamic design.
Afternoon: Wander through the labyrinthine streets of the Albaicin neighborhood, a UNESCO World Heritage Site. Explore the Moorish heritage and enjoy panoramic views of the Alhambra and the city.
Evening: Experience the vibrant atmosphere of Granada's tapas scene in the bustling district of Calle Navas. Hop from one tapas bar to another, sampling a variety of local dishes.
Morning: Visit the stunning Granada Cathedral, an architectural masterpiece blending Gothic and Renaissance styles. Marvel at the intricate details and explore the chapels inside.
Afternoon: Discover the tranquil beauty of the Generalife Gardens, adjacent to the Alhambra. Take a leisurely stroll through the elegant gardens filled with fountains, flowers, and lush greenery.
Evening: Enjoy a flamenco show in the Sacromonte neighborhood, the birthplace of this passionate art form. Let the rhythmic music and captivating dance transport you to the heart of Andalusian culture.
Morning: Before bidding farewell to Granada, explore the historic neighborhood of Realejo. Admire the charming architecture and visit the Casa de los Tiros, a museum showcasing Granada's cultural heritage.
Afternoon: Complete your Andalusian adventure with a visit to the Hammam Al Andalus, a luxurious Arab bathhouse where you can relax in thermal baths and indulge in a traditional spa experience.
Evening: Departure from Granada with cherished memories of your captivating journey through Andalucia.
